Twitter users are also anxiously awaiting SCOTUS decisions today. One bit of news has come out already: The Justices will hear a a challenge to Obama’s recess appointments:

Here is what the outcome of the case could mean:
#SCOTUS to hear NLRB v. Canning. This case could determine viability of recess appts & determine what constitutes a Senate recess.
— Chad Pergram (@ChadPergram) June 24, 2013
#SCOTUS to decide if prez's "recess-appointment power may be exercised when the Senate is convening every 3 days in pro forma sessions"
— Chad Pergram (@ChadPergram) June 24, 2013
If SCOTUS rules against the Pres on his NLRB recess appointments, could also impact Richard Cordray, CFPB Director, appointed same day.
